Monthly climate in Talmontiers, France

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Talmontiers features a oceanic climate (Cfb). Temperatures typically range between 4 °C (40 °F) and 19 °C (66 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-9 °C (16 °F) or can rise to as high as 38 °C (101 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 830 mm (32.7 inches) and receives 146 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Talmontiers enjoys an average of 3471 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 8 hours 12 minutes to 16 hours 11 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Talmontiers, France

The warmest months in Talmontiers are June, July and August,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 17 to 19 °C (63 - 66 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in January, February and December, when daily mean temperatures range from 4 to 6 °C (40 - 43 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Talmontiers experiences 24 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 29 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Talmontiers, France

Talmontiers usually has the most precipitation in May, October and December, with an average of 14 rainy days and 92 mm (3.6 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Talmontiers are April, July and September. On average, 43 mm (1.7 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Talmontiers, France

The sunniest months in Talmontiers are May, June and July, when the sun shines an average of 13 hours 10 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Talmontiers: January, February and December receive an average of 5 hours 14 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Talmontiers, France

Talmontiers exper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in May, June and August,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 8 - 9, which corresponds to the Very High category of sun exposure. January, November and December are in the Low ex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 2.
